Q: What are the age definitions for each pass?
A: Adult is for ages 37-64 (at time of purchase).
Young Adult (30-36) is for ages 30-36 (at time of purchase).
Young Adult (25-29) is for ages 25-29 (at time of purchase).
Young Adult (19-24) is for ages 19-24 (at time of purchase).
Youth is for ages 11-18 (at time of purchase).
Senior is for guests ages 65-74 (at time of purchase).
Super Senior is for guests ages 75+ (at time of purchase).
Snowbowl My Weekday Pass is for all ages. Snowbowl My Weekday passholders can ski any 1-5 days between Monday and Friday at Arizona Snowbowl. Plus they can ski or ride on weekends, holidays and blackout dates by purchasing one adult lift ticket at 20% off the window rate. Blackout dates: Saturdays, Sundays and the following dates: 12/28/20 – 12/31/20.
Parent Share Pass allows two parents to share one pass. Parents must prove that their child is age 3 years old or younger when picking up their pass. This pass is only valid at Snowbowl. Parent Transferable passholders can buy one adult lift ticket at 20% off the window rate if both parents are skiing on the same date.
